Our company was founded in the 1980s under the name Sim Furnishing. In 2005, we changed our business model and was incorporated as Simfur Design Sdn Bhd. Simfur Design provides one - stop custom made wooden furniture to both residential and commercial customers. Our streamlined service includes design and consultation, manufacture and install, as well as alias with relevant contractors (electrician, plumber, concrete, flooring, curtain and wallpaper). We believe in design x functionality that matches customers' personality and budget. Our designers and skilled workers are more than willing to advice and help make each piece of furniture to customers' satisfaction. Unlike many designer house that send designs to outside manufactureres, we have our own workshop to fabricate furniture that puts us on advantage. In-house fabrication allows designers closely monitor progress and quality before the woodworks are delivered to customers.

Primary Purpose of the Role:
The PDA is responsible for Solution Compliance for a Bid, Project or Product Development phase (as a Project).
Key Interactions:
The Project Design Authority (PDA) is responsible to the Training and Simulation Design Authority & Programme Manager/Director. They support the Solution Architect &, the Solution Engineering Manager, through key interaction with the Customer and End User, to ensure the respective Training and Simulations solution is for the fit-for-purpose.
Key Responsibilities:
The PDA ensures that the technical solution is feasible, competitive and meets customer expectations or product requirements, in terms of cost, innovation, performance, schedule, etc.
Acts as the primary technical leader of the bid or project team. Acts as lead technical interface with the Customer.
Monitor, review, advise and assist with technical issues across the programme.
Ensures the solution compliance with product polices and requirements, as well as applicable legislation & regulations (i.e. Cybersecurity, export restrictions, Environmental/HSE, safety..)
Checks that the Engineering Environment (process, practices and tools) for the Solution is consistent with Country/Company requirements, and overall Solution cost, technical risks & schedule.
Reviews together with the SEM (System Engineering Manager) the technical risks and opportunities and the related mitigation plans throughout the bid or project.
Prepares the DVa and submits it to the Design Authority (DA) approval.
Approves the main bid/project engineering reviews and deliverables.
Organises when appropriate technical meetings and peer reviews together with the Architect (ARC), Subject Matter Experts (SME) and the SEM and other stakeholders (industry, services, specialists.), in order to perform the solution technical assessment and validation.

Project Manager, Instructional Systems DesignKBR is seeking a Project Manager for Instructional Systems Design (ISD) work supporting a government client in Orlando, FL. You will lead a team supporting analysis, curriculum design, and courseware development for trainers and simulators for surface vessels such as Littoral Combat Ships (LCS) and Frigates, equipment which interfaces with surface vessels, multi-platform systems, and potentially other Department of Defense (DoD) platforms or weapon systems. Your team will be part of and coordinate with a broader team which provides engineering, logistics management, and ISD support to DoD organizations developing trainers and simulators for military aircraft, unmanned aerial vehicles, naval surface vessels, and unmanned/semi-autonomous watercraft.

About Us:
Design Group operates from more than 45 offices in the United States and India, providing engineering, consulting and technical services for the world’s leading companies in the food and beverage, life sciences, advanced technology, industrial and other market sectors. Our nearly 1,500 technical and engineering experts have direct industry experience in industrial automation, control system integration, facility and process engineering, architecture, construction management, regulatory compliance, enterprise technology and other consulting services.
